Family Foreign Language Education Planning Research in China: Key Issues and Future Directions
Hao Xu
PASAA: Journal of Language Teaching and Learning in Thailand, v70 p1-29 2025
This positioning paper maps the landscape of family foreign language education planning (FFLEP) research in China, framing key issues and future directions within the broader context of language acquisition planning studies. FFLEP is conceptualized as a dynamic process where families actively engage in planning and implementing foreign language education for their members. The paper identifies the key elements characterizing FFLEP and delves into the multifaceted role of the family in this endeavor. By situating FFLEP within the intersecting domains of language education and language policy and planning, the paper contributes to a more comprehensive understanding of this emerging field and sets the agenda for future research.
